Fair Hearing Rights Preservation After Agency Action

Agencies can't simply strip away your right to challenge their decisions once they've acted, but you must exercise that right within strict timeframes and according to procedural rules they set. Knowing exactly what agency action triggers your hearing rights—and what actions don't—prevents the frustration of discovering too late that you needed to move faster or follow different steps.

Why It Matters

When a government agency reduces, suspends, or terminates benefits, recipients have a legally protected right to request a fair hearing to challenge that decision, and in many cases they can continue receiving benefits at the prior level while the hearing is pending if they request it within a specific deadline.

Missing the fair hearing request deadline or failing to request continuation of benefits can result in permanent loss of both the benefits and the right to appeal.
